App Store now officially available
The App Store has been accessible for awhile now, but it is now official. Fire up your copy of iTunes and you'll be greeted with a new addition to the left hand navigation: App Store. As with the other sections of the iTunes Store you'll find a number of sections: New Apps, Top Apps, Top Free Apps, and more.The iPhone 2.0 firmware hasn't been released as of yet, but browsing the App Store should keep your mind off that for a little while.
